Essential Care Techniques for Healthy Growth

### Essential Care Techniques for Healthy Growth
If you’re a plant lover looking to elevate your indoor gardening game, achieving fuller, healthier potted plants is likely at the top of your list. Professional gardeners recommend several practical strategies to enhance plant vitality and ensure they flourish. First, pruning and pinching your plants is essential; by trimming or pinching back the tips, you stimulate new growth that results in a bushier appearance. Remember to prune just above a leaf node to maximize results, tailoring your techniques based on the specific type of plant you have. Secondly, consider the sunlight exposure—plants that appear leggy often crave more light; moving them to brighter spots or using grow lights can significantly improve their health. Additionally, filling pots strategically by introducing more plants into a single container—without overcrowding—creates a lush look; using cuttings from tropical plants, which are easy to propagate, adds to the fullness. Transitioning your potted plants outdoors during warmer months provides them with fresh air and natural light, nurturing their growth while ensuring they are sheltered from extreme weather. Furthermore, maintaining increased humidity for tropical houseplants is vital; using a humidifier to keep levels above 50% can prevent drooping and foster robust growth. Finally, supporting vining plants with trellises or stakes allows them to climb freely, leading to a vibrant display. Creating the Ideal Environment for Potted Plants

Creating the ideal environment for your potted plants is essential for their health and vibrancy. Each plant species has unique requirements, and understanding these needs allows you to tailor their surroundings for optimal growth. Start by considering the planting medium; a good-quality potting mix rich in organic matter retains moisture and provides essential nutrients. Drainage is equally important—ensure pots have appropriate drainage holes to prevent waterlogged roots, which can lead to rot. In addition to light and humidity, temperature plays a critical role; most houseplants thrive in temperatures between 65°F to 75°F, so place them away from drafts or heating vents. Regularly checking for pests and diseases can prevent issues before they become severe, and don’t hesitate to rotate your pots occasionally to ensure even exposure to light.
